A dart would slide over the little pole and then you would shoot it. Here is a pic of the internals after I cut the barrel off.

I sawed the barrel off at the base and slapped a 2" barrel of 17/32" on there. I sanded down the plastic and a bit of the brass so the epoxy had something to bite into. Then I just carefully put it back together. the wings open up and the front two arms pull apart when you pull back on the plunger then you let go and they snap back together. Pretty cool looking. I took a video so you guys can see the wings and arms motion.

I am pleased with the gun to be honest. It gets about 40-45 feet on average with a BB weighted asshole dart. This creature feels like more of a slingshot then a gun but its fun to own and looks good in the arsenal because of its unique colors and firing style.
